Research published in the American Chemical Society's Applied Polymer Materials describes a technique to assess the tack properties hair styling polymers.

Scientists from Technische Universität München devised the approach utilizing nylon fiber assemblies coated with pressure-sensitive adhesives; e.g., polymer blends. Cylindrical stamps are then contacted with the fibers to measure tackiness. For additional details, see the complete article

Styling products with a natural feel are generally preferred by today's consumers. As such, measuring their tack property during development could support the formulator's efforts toward creating soft, natural feeling hair styling agents.
